Abstract

The B19' martensite phase in Ni-44.55wt%Ti shape memory alloys were investigated by means of the X-ray diffraction. Several X-ray patterns were measured at lower and higher temperature of martensitic transformation and a X-ray pattern simulation by RIETAN-2000 added to determine the crystal structure. At higher temperature than that of martensitic transformation all of crystal consisted in B2 structure. However, the crystal structures at lower temperature of -10℃ consisted in not only B19' but also B2. The ratio of both structures might be 1:1 at martensite phase.
